Abstract
- This study was conducted cross sectionally in Maumere, Sikka Regency, East Nusa Tenggara Province, that previously known as one of malaria endemic area with high incidence of low birth weight (LBW) cases. In this study the peripheral and umbilical blood samples as well as placental tissues were collected from mother delivered their babies with LBW at the TC Hiller Regional Hospital. All of the blood samples were examined for the presence of parasites by microscopic and PCR technique, while the plasma levels of VEGF, PlGF, and VEGFR-1, VEGFR-2, and HIF 1-�� were determined using ELISA. The sequestration of infected erythrocytes and hemozoin were determined from placental histological slides and the expression of placenta angiogenic factors were observed by immunofluorescent technique.
